What Is Order Accuracy Data?
Order Accuracy Data captures the precision of order fulfillment operations, tracking wrong item, wrong quantity, and mispick rates across warehouse facilities and shifts. This quality control data is essential for identifying and quantifying the errors that cost retailers and logistics operators millions annually. By measuring order accuracy metrics, businesses gain visibility into operational bottlenecks and can implement targeted improvements through technology, process standardization, and employee training. The data serves as a foundation for data-driven decision-making that reduces costly returns, reshipments, and customer service interactions while protecting brand reputation in an era where social media can amplify negative customer experiences.

What error categories does Order Accuracy Data typically include?
Order Accuracy Data typically captures wrong item picks, wrong quantities, and mispick errors. Some datasets may also include partial order fulfillment, damaged goods identified at QC, or label errors. The specific categories depend on the source warehouse system and quality control process.
How much can order accuracy errors cost a business?
Costs include returns processing, reshipments, customer service labor, and lost customer loyalty. Studies show that a 5% improvement in customer retention (driven by order accuracy) can boost profits by 25% to 95%. Errors also damage brand reputation, particularly when negative experiences spread on social media.
What technologies reduce order accuracy errors most effectively?
Robotic picking systems, barcode scanning, automated verification, real-time analytics, and AI-driven anomaly detection are proven effective. Case studies show robotic picking can reduce errors by 60%, while advanced data integration and analytics have achieved 45% reductions in processing errors.
